D995 UTA is a 1998 Fiat Ducato in Cream with a 2,600c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 1998 Fiat Ducato models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.4% with a typical mileage of 66,334 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Ducato f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 34,174 recorded failures. If you're considering buying D995 UTA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Ducato typ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 28 years old, this Fiat Ducato is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
